Thailand Elite "Thai Yili" Premium Card (Thailand Elite)
Thailand National Yili Premium CardIt is a membership sponsored by the Thai government
Thailand Elite, or Thailand VIP, is the world's first government-sponsored national club membership. Thailand Elite members can enjoy multiple visits to the Kingdom of Thailand. Thailand Elite" members are entitled to multiple long-term entry visas to the Kingdom of Thailand and visa renewal services, and enjoy national VIP treatment every time they enter or leave the Kingdom of Thailand. The program is designed to attract and encourage high net worth individuals who repeatedly visit Thailand for business or leisure purposes.
Thailand Thai Yili Premium Card Category
Thailand Elite "Benefit Card" or Thailand VIP is divided into 8 sub-categories: Individual, Family, Corporate; also divided into 5, 10 and 20 years.
Thailand Elite "Thai Elite" Card Length of Stay Limitations
5, 10 and 20 years, with at least one departure per year.
Malaysia Second Home Program MM2H
The Malaysia My Second Home program (usually abbreviated as "MM2H"), the official website of Malaysia (http://www.mm2h.gov.my/) could not be connected when I was writing this article, attached.MM2H Wikipedia
The Malaysia My Second Home (MM2H) is a programme promoted by the Malaysia Tourism Authority and the Immigration Department of Malaysia, foreigners who fulfill certain criteria may apply, and a successful applicant is allowed to bring a spouse, an unmarried child under the age of 21, and parents who are over 21. fulfill certain criteria may apply, and a successful applicant is allowed to bring a spouse, an unmarried child under the age of 21, and parents who are over 60 years old. 60 years old.
MM2H is an international residency program issued by the Malaysian government and can be applied by foreigners who meet certain criteria and successful applicants can bring along their spouses, unmarried children below 21 years of age and parents above 60 years of age.
From January 2009, the Malaysian Government will allow individuals to apply for the Malaysian Second Home Program "MM2H" on their own. Applicants will no longer be required to use an agent, or any third party.

Malaysia Second Home Program MM2H|Eligibility|Conditions|Preparation Materials
Applicants aged 50 or above:
- Open a time deposit account of MYR350,000.00 at the local office in Malaysia
- Proof showing a monthly offshore government pension of at least MYR10,000.00.
Applicants under 50 years of age
Produce a Liquid Assets Asset Certificate showing assets of at least RM500,000 with a monthly offshore income of RM10,000 and must also have a Malaysian Fixed Deposit of MYR300,000.00 with a local bank.
Access to deposits
A maximum of MYR150,000.00 can be withdrawn after the one year period for the purchase of a home, education of Malaysian children, and medical purposes. However, under the program, a minimum balance of MYR150,000.00 must be maintained from the second year onwards and throughout the period of stay in Malaysia. All applicants must demonstrate that they have sufficient funds to sustain themselves for the duration of their 10-year visa. ..
After the one-year period, participants who fulfill the criteria for time deposits can withdraw up to a further MYR50,000.00 for home purchase, Malaysian children's education, and medical purposes. However, a minimum balance of MYR100,000.00 must be maintained from the second year onwards and for the entire period of stay in Malaysia under the program.
